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,352,636,727 Lastest Block: 2,011,107 Utxos: 1,982,589
Nodes: 306 OmniXEP Contracts: 281
Electra Protocol [XEP] Transactions for address: xFc4j1RxekMvswkDd6U5YsmbZR9hR8Jkpd
No transactions for this address and token.